IN THE HIGH COURT OF JUDICATURE AT BOMBAY

CIVIL APPELLATE JURISDICTION WRIT PETITION NO.8686 OF 2017 Maruti Manohar Rathod & Anr.

.. Petitioners

Versus

Snajay Ramesh Rathod .. Respondent Mr. R.S. Sinhasane a/w T.N. Khairnar I/b U.R. Mankapure for petitioners.

CORAM : K.K. TATED, J.

DATE : 20 FEBRUARY 2019.

P.C:- .

Heard learned Counsel for the petitioners.

2.

By this writ petition under Article 227 of the Constitution of India, petitioner/original defendant is challenging the order dated 22.06.2017 passed by Civil Judge, Junior Division, Peth Vadgaon below Exhibit-32 in Regular Civil Suit No.56 of 2016 rejecting petitioner/original defendant's application for appointment of Court Commissioner for local investigation and for submitting the report about the suit property. 3.

It is to be noted that, in the present proceedings, the respondent/original plaintiff filed Regular Civil Suit No.56 of 2016 for an order of injunction restraining the defendants from S.C.Magar

77-wp-8686-2017.doc disturbing his possession and or carrying out any construction on the suit property.

4.

Bare reading of the application below Exhibit-32 filed by the petitioner for appointment of Court Commissioner shows that they want to bring the certain documents on record which shows that respondents/original plaintiffs are not owner of the suit property. The Court Commissioner cannot be appointed to ascertain the ownership of the property. Apart from that the trial Court has considered all the issues at the time of rejecting petitioner's application for appointment of Court Commissioner. Therefore, I do not fine any reason to entertain the present writ petition.

5.

Hence, writ petition stands rejected.

6.

No order as to costs.
